ATLANTA (41NBC/WMGT) — The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ets football team will open the 2026 season in primetime and will have multiple nationally televised games during the first month of the season, according to the ACC.

The Atlantic Coast Conference released kickoff times and TV assignments Wednesday for the opening weeks of the 2026 college football season.

Georgia Tech opens the season September 3 at home against Colorado at 8 p.m. on ESPN.

The Yellow Jackets will then host Tennessee on September 12 at 7 p.m. on ESPN in one of the ACC’s featured nonconference matchups of the early season.

Georgia Tech will also host Mercer on September 19 at noon on the ACC Network.

The ACC also announced the Yellow Jackets’ September 26 road game at Stanford will kick off at 10:30 p.m. Eastern on ESPN.

The conference says additional kickoff times and TV assignments will be announced later in the season.
